In a recent post shared by one of our Facebook Group members, the following was posted: 

 

"A DI asked his recruits how much they think the firing pin in their weapon weighs.

 

Answers ranged from grams to ounces.
 
Then DI instructed a recruit to hold out the firing pin as long as he could. After a minute the weight of the pin started to become uncomfortable. After 5 minutes, he had an ache in his arm and started to wonder how long he can go on like this. After a half hour his arm was shaking and began to feel numb and paralyzed. As time went on, the weight didn’t change, yet it still became harder and harder to hold.
 
The drill instructor says to the class, “The stresses and worries in this life are like that firing pin. Think about them for a minute and nothing happens. Think about them a bit longer and they begin to hurt. And if you think about them all day long, you will feel paralyzed – incapable of doing anything. You start to wonder how much longer you can go on like this.”
 
(Time to deflect with humor). This Drill Instructor was definitely not a Marine Corps DI !! Must have been Air Force or Navy.
 
(Time to be serious again)Remember to put the firing pin down. Talk to your battle buddies when you need to and don’t hold everything inside. The weight of our jobs and life can and may become overwhelming. Please look out for your battle buddies, shift mates, response area partners, zone partners, bunk mates, etc."
